Rogue Nation: The U.S. in Global Conflicts
This chapter explores the historical view of the United States as a rogue nation, emphasizing its persistent engagement in conflicts rather than peace. It critically examines the consequences of U.S. foreign policies under various administrations, particularly focusing on the implications of a potential second term for Trump on global stability and democracy.
